Does liver cancer cause right shoulder pain?

Does liver cancer cause right shoulder pain?

Liver cancer pain is commonly focused on the top right of the abdominal area, near the right shoulder blade. The pain can sometimes extend into the back. It can also be felt in the lower right portion of the rib cage. The pain might be accompanied by swelling in the abdomen and in the legs and ankles.

Can liver problems cause shoulder pain?

Liver disease can be a source of referred pain, in which discomfort is noticed in an area other than where the actual problem is. The shoulders and neck are common sites of pain referred from the liver. Liver disease can also cause inflammation throughout the body, leading to a general feeling of discomfort.

What does shoulder pain from liver cancer feel like?

Right Shoulder-Blade Pain This is the case with liver cancer. The tumor (or spread from the tumor) can irritate nerves that tell your brain the pain is coming from your shoulder blade when it’s actually coming from the liver. This pain is typically felt in the right shoulder, though it may occur on either side.

Why does liver affect right shoulder?

How you ask? Well the phrenic nerve that goes to the liver comes from the neck and has some nerve branches that got to the shoulder and the shoulder blade. When nerves enter the spinal cord, they all go into the same part so when you affect one nerve lower down, it affects the nerve higher up!

What organ causes right shoulder pain?

When your gallbladder is inflamed and swollen, it irritates your phrenic nerve. Your phrenic nerve stretches from the abdomen, through the chest, and into your neck. Each time you eat a fatty meal, it aggravates the nerve and causes referred pain in your right shoulder blade.

What does shoulder pain from cancer feel like?

People who have shoulder pain from lung cancer often describe it as a radiating pain from the shoulder down their arms to their hands. There may also be numbness or tingling. At other times, it can feel like a deep ache.

What does a Pancoast tumor feel like?

Patients with an advanced Pancoast tumor may feel intense, constant or radiating pain in their arms, around their chest wall, between their shoulder blades or traveling into their upper back. Patients whose tumor has spread into the scalene muscles may also feel pain in their armpit.

What does it mean when your right shoulder hurts?

The most common cause of right shoulder and arm pain is an issue with your rotator cuff, such as tendinitis or bursitis. Other potential causes include fractures, arthritis, and cervical radiculopathy.

What does liver Mets look like on CT scan?

Metastases may look like almost any lesion that occurs in the liver. Hemangiomas may be easily mistaken for metastases when they are multiple. On nonenhanced CT, they often form well-defined hypoattenuating lesions that mimic vascular metastases. On contrast-enhanced scans, they show peripheral enhancement.
